Output 8ea32121291af17cc20496751a3b648a1c636746e68a6ebd5865d9bd95c2d0e3:1

value
37419000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8686da47bb86c91c460010c9db3c5c1ea3373f OP_EQUAL
address
MQuR5CE6gQAynP9PWHMebrof1yDoETZFmy
transaction
8ea32121291af17cc20496751a3b648a1c636746e68a6ebd5865d9bd95c2d0e3
spent
true